FineReport教程:条件汇总与多维度报表实现

需积分: 50 86 下载量 83 浏览量 更新于2024-08-10 收藏 2.67MB PDF 举报
"这篇文档是关于FineReport报表工具的详细教程,主要涵盖了如何使用该工具进行条件汇总等高级报表制作技巧。文档分为多个章节,详细介绍了FineReport的各种功能和应用场景,包括但不限于同期比、分组汇总、条件汇总、排名、组内序号、累计报表、占比报表、主子报表、网格式填报表、分组报表、纵向分片、多层交叉报表、计算列的汇总等。此外,还涉及到报表的保存与预览,以及如何通过服务器进行浏览。文档末尾进行了总结,强调FineReport作为一个报表工具,其易用性和高效性,可以有效地弥补Excel在复杂报表设计上的不足。" 在FineReport报表工具中,条件汇总是一项重要的功能,允许用户根据特定条件对数据进行统计和分析。例如,描述中提到的1.1表样设计,增加了"奖金大于2000的人数"这一行,这需要在D6单元格中填写公式 "=sum(D3>2000)" 来计算满足条件的数据个数。这种条件汇总方法对于数据分析和决策制定非常有用,可以帮助用户快速了解符合特定条件的数据量。 在实际操作中,用户需要保存报表设计,并进行预览。文档指导用户将报表保存到指定路径,例如"%FineReport_HOME%/WebReport/WEB-INF/reportlets/com/doc/4.6.cpt",然后通过服务器启动预览,通过浏览器访问特定URL(如"http://localhost:8079/WebReport/ReportServer?reportlet=/com/doc/4.6.cpt")查看报表效果。 FineReport不仅提供基础的报表设计,还支持各种复杂的报表类型,例如占比报表,它能够展示各部分数据占整体的比例;主子报表,用于在一个报表中同时展示主表和子表的数据;多层交叉报表,可处理多维度的数据分析。此外,FineReport还具备动态背景色、高亮显示、数据格式设置等功能,提升报表的视觉效果和交互体验。 通过FineReport,用户可以实现计算列的汇总,对特定列的数据进行总计或平均等运算,进行合法性数据检查,确保录入的数据符合业务规则。填报功能则允许用户在报表中输入数据,支持日期和数值的自动计算,提高了数据录入的效率和准确性。 总结来说,FineReport是一款强大的报表设计和分析工具,其丰富的功能和易用性使得用户可以轻松地创建和管理各种复杂的报表,满足企业日常数据分析和决策支持的需求。无论是简单的数据汇总还是复杂的多维度分析,FineReport都能提供有效的解决方案。